Dynamics versus thermodynamics: the sea ice thickness distribution / Christian Haas.

Title: Dynamics versus thermodynamics: the sea ice thickness distribution / Christian Haas.
Author(s): Haas, Christian.
Date: 2010.
Publisher: Oxford: Wiley-Blackwell
In: Sea ice. (2010.),
Abstract: Presents physical and statistical approaches to understanding and simulating ice thickness distribution on local and regional scales, and reviews current knowledge of global ice thickness distribution. Discusses components of ice thickness evolution modelling (thermodynamics, ice divergence and advection, ice deformation/convergence, and melting), methods of determining ice thickness (upward-looking sonars, electromagnetic induction sounding, satellite altimetry, etc.), and some results of observations of variability and trends in Arctic regions.
